Bodegraven Cheese Museum

The Cheese Museum shows the history of cheese in Bodegraven. The farmer’s cheese from Gouda and the surrounding area is world famous, but it’s a lesser known fact that almost all of this cheese is stored in Bodegraven. It is estimated that around 20 million kilograms of cheese are stored in Bodegraven-Reeuwijk. The museum uses a range of objects, books and films to show how the dairy farmers make their cheese. Young people can follow their own interactive tour with a cheese tablet in hand.
